Leaming Surname Meaning

From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history

This surname is derived from a geographical locality. 'of Leeming,' a village near Bedale, Yorkshire, (a) Personal, 'the son of Leming' (v. Halliwell, and Promptorium Parvulorum pp. 295-6). In the Towneley Mysteries Leming is a horse's name, from its bright, flashing colour. 'Say, Malle and Stott, Wille ye not go? Lemynge, Morelle, White-horne,' The editor says that Leming as a cow's name occurs in the will of a West Riding yeoman. That Leming was a personal name and became a surname seems indubitable.

Stephen Leming, Oxfordshire, 1273. Hundred Rolls.

William Leming, Oxfordshire, ibid.

Stephen de Leminge, Kent, ibid.

Johannes Lemyng, 1379: Poll Tax of Yorkshire.

Isolda Lemyng, 1379: ibid.

Willelmus Lemyng, sutor, 1379: ibid.

1545. Buried — Urseley (Ursula) Lemynge: St. Dionis Backchurch.

1645. William Leming (Essex) and Ellen Rolt: Marriage Lic. (London).

A Dictionary of English and Welsh Surnames (1896) by Charles Wareing Endell Bardsley

A chapelry in Yorkshire.

Patronymica Britannica (1860) by Mark Antony Lower

How Common Is The Last Name Leaming? popularity and diffusion

The surname Leaming is the 297,114th most widespread surname throughout the world It is held by approximately 1 in 5,680,083 people. The surname occurs mostly in The Americas, where 79 percent of Leaming are found; 79 percent are found in North America and 79 percent are found in Anglo-North America. Leaming is also the 2,446,817th most commonly used first name globally, borne by 20 people.

It is most commonly used in The United States, where it is held by 975 people, or 1 in 371,753. In The United States Leaming is mostly concentrated in: California, where 8 percent live, Missouri, where 8 percent live and Washington, where 8 percent live. Without taking into account The United States Leaming exists in 11 countries. It is also common in New Zealand, where 10 percent live and England, where 8 percent live.

Leaming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The prevalency of Leaming has changed over time. In The United States the number of people carrying the Leaming last name rose 360 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in England it decreased 37 percent between 1881 and 2014.
